JVM keen on political tie-up with AAP

The Jharkhand Vikas Morcha (Prajatantrik) today said it was keen for a political tie-up with the Aam Admi Party (AAP) in the state and dismissed reports that it was a one-sided effort by the JVM.
"The common agenda of both JVM and AAP is anti-corruption. So we welcome talks between the two parties," JVM's principal general secretary Pradip Yadav told a news conference here.
Yadav said JVM's Lok Sabha member Ajay Kumar had some discussions with the leaders.
Claiming he had "political discussions" with the AAP's top level leadership, Kumar disagreed to a query that AAP had reportedly said it was JVM's one-sided effort.
"Who said it, tell me one name... I spoke to the top leadership; at Prasantji's (Bhusan) level," Kumar, who was present at the press conference, retorted to the question.
"It was only political discussions," he said when asked to throw light on any tie-up with AAP in Jharkhand.
